Principal Software Engineer - Data Access

Roblox
San Mateo, CA

Roblox Storage team powers the data foundation behind every experience on the platform. As a Principal Software Engineer for Data Access , you will architect and build the next‑generation managed OLTP data access layer — engineered for extreme scale, global availability , and uncompromising security. You will design core infrastructure capable of serving hundreds of millions of queries per second while ensuring reliable, low‑latency access to data worldwide.

The challenges are large‑scale , highly technical , and business‑critical : you will shape foundational storage systems, evolve platform‑wide scalability and reliability, and provide strong technical leadership that raises engineering quality across teams. This work requires deep innovation, clear architectural vision, and a passion for distributed systems — redefining how Roblox engineers build, access, and trust data at scale.

You will:


  • Partner with Product, Engineering, and Security teams to define long‑term strategy and technical requirements for the Data Access platform.

  • Lead the architecture, implementation, and operation of our storage Infra‑as‑a‑Service offerings, setting the engineering bar for scalability, reliability, and system hardening across teams.

  • Improve and scale our large distributed 24x7 services and deliver features with urgency, cost efficiency, zero down time, and high reliability.

  • Design and build frameworks or tools to automate development, testing, deployment, management, and monitoring of mission critical services.

  • Collaborate with partner teams, producing project work plans, measurable metrics, delivery milestones, rollout plans, oncall alerts, and runbooks while leveraging existing technology stack.

  • Give a high level of attention to creating high quality and reusable code, keeping development continuous without compromising site reliability.

  • Improve SLAs across the platform and reduce end‑to‑end rollout time for critical storage and data-access features.

You have:


  • Strong experience designing and delivering large-scale distributed systems handling millions of real-time requests per second.

  • Deep data management knowledge in one or more of the following technologies: RDBMS (CockroachDB, SQL Server, Postgres, MySQL, RDB), Caching (Redis), Kafka, KV store (DynamoDB, Cassandra).

  • Strong experience building deployment pipelines on top of container orchestrators like Kubernetes or Nomad and service discovery systems like Consul.

  • Strong experience with programming languages like Rust, Go, Java, or C++.

  • Strong scripting and test automation abilities.

  • Experience with telemetry stacks, like Grafana, Prometheus, AlertManager, and Kibana.

  • BS degree (or equivalent professional experience) in Computer Science, with at least 7 years of hands-on experience.

Posted 2026-01-07

Recommended Jobs

Medical Receptionist - Full Time

Therapy Partners Group
Ceres, CA

Starting Hourly: $18.00 - $19.00 per hour depending on experience as a Medical Receptionist.  Golden Bear Physical Therapy, a member of Therapy Partners Group, has been the premier provider for out…

View Details
Posted 2026-01-13

Senior Software Engineer, Identity Platform

Openai
San Francisco, CA

About the Team Our team brings OpenAI’s most capable technology to the world through our products. Most recently, we released ChatGPT, GPT-4, the Whisper API, and DALL-E. We empower consumers and de…

View Details
Posted 2025-12-19

Investor Accountant I

Pennymac
Moorpark, CA

Investor Accountant I Location Moorpark, CA : PENNYMAC: Pennymac (NYSE: PFSI) is a specialty financial services firm with a comprehensive mortgage platform and integrated business focused on the pro…

View Details
Posted 2026-01-09

Sr. Data Engineer

Slickdeals
Paradise, CA

About Slickdeals: We believe shopping should feel like winning. That’s why 10 million people come to Slickdeals to swap tips, upvote the best finds, and share the thrill of a great deal. Tog…

View Details
Posted 2025-11-28

Senior Product Manager, Time Tools

Gusto
Los Angeles, CA

About Gusto At Gusto, we're on a mission to grow the small business economy. We handle the hard stuff—like payroll, health insurance, 401(k)s, and HR—so owners can focus on their craft and custo…

View Details
Posted 2025-12-13

Software Engineer, Starlink Customer Success

Spacex
Sunnyvale, CA

SpaceX was founded under the belief that a future where humanity is out exploring the stars is fundamentally more exciting than one where we are not. Today SpaceX is actively developing the technolog…

View Details
Posted 2026-01-07

Software Engineer, Frontier Systems

Openai
San Francisco, CA

About the Team The Frontier Systems team at OpenAI builds, launches, and supports the largest supercomputers in the world that OpenAI uses for its most cutting edge model training. We take data c…

View Details
Posted 2026-01-07

Software Engineer Networking

Ericsson
Santa Clara, CA

Minimum Education: Bachelor's/master's degree in computer science or a related field Minimum Years of Experience: 6+ years of experience in Networking domain Strong knowledge of networking protocols (…

View Details
Posted 2025-12-13

Esports Event Producer

Riot Games
Los Angeles, CA

The Events Producer manages the production of our digital, studio and stadium events within North America. In this position, you will fill the role of the Events Producer for our live events in No…

View Details
Posted 2026-01-06

Staff/Tech Lead Manager - Uber Eats App Experience

Uber
San Francisco, CA

About the Role: The Inspire org at Uber Eats is looking for a seasoned Staff Tech Lead Manager to supercharge the next 5 years of Uber Eats strategy and make our marketplace a home for discovery a…

View Details
Posted 2025-11-21